A list of domains allowed to perform Cross-Origin Resource Sharing (CORS)
requests. This applies to both JSON-RPC and WebSocket requests. Values

should be in the format ``hostname:port``, should not specify any scheme and
be separated by either a comma or newline. Additionally, the ``port`` should
not be specified if it is the default (80 for http, 443 for https).
Same-origin requests (i.e. requests from Mopidy's web server) are always
allowed and so you don't need an entry for those. However, if your requests
originate from a different web server, you will need to add an entry for

that server in this list. For example, to allow requests from a web server
at 'http://www.my.web-client.com' you would specify the entry
'www.my.web-client.com'.
